(E92) DME/CAS sync using INPA.

Hello guys,

I recently used INPA on my E92 325D M SPORT and reset the CAS counter to fix the steering lock error.

It fixed the error but now my car turns over but won't start. The error I get is 4a63 - EWS tampering protection.

I'm assuming it's because the DME/CAS is out of sync now and I know it can be done in INPA, however, I get the error when selecting my engine (M57TU2) in INPA.

Requested control unit not found D62M57D0,D60M57B0
Control unit found, D62M57A0.


Any help would be great thanks.

You have a DDE not DME. From an old thread:

Quote:
Originally Posted by makkan00 View Post
As you told me that error is 4A63....
Solution:
Re-align the DDE and EWS

How you do it?

1- Launch inpa
2- Select the engine
3- Choose the model of the engine (in your case
DDE6 = 318d, 320d, 325d, 330d, 335d ( 03/2005 - 09/2007 )
DDE7 = 318d, 320d, 325d, 330d, 335d ( 09/2007 - )

4- Select option: activate (usually F5 but check in your inpa)
5- Select option: EWS
6- Select option: reset ----> in progress ----> click ok
7- Bak to the main menu, ie, back, back, back, and close the INPA
8- Open the inpa and check the errors. That errors should have gone by now.
9- Turn the ignition off, remove the obd connector and start your car.

Please share the results.
If you still don't have the engine in INPA. Reinstall with a good copy from the bimmergeeks website.

I have the same problem that I have spend some hours on already. Inpa started with the statement "control unit found: D72N47B0" and that is one he could not find. Eventually found the IPO file DDE7N47.ipo though that did not work. Then moved on to DD7XN47.ipo and that continues further and then mentions a motor mismatch and language mismatch (last one not relevant). Anybody know if I can get the correct IPO for my DDE 7.2.1?
